In which industries are tubular centrifuges commonly used?

Centrifugation is a widely used separation technique in various industries to separate particles from a liquid medium. Tubular centrifuges are a type of centrifuge that is commonly used in several industries due to their efficiency and effectiveness in separation processes. In this article, we will explore the industries where tubular centrifuges are commonly used and the benefits they offer in each sector.

Pharmaceutical Industry

The pharmaceutical industry is one of the primary sectors where tubular centrifuges are widely used. These centrifuges play a crucial role in the production of pharmaceutical products by separating solids from liquids or immiscible liquids from each other. Tubular centrifuges are commonly used in pharmaceutical manufacturing processes such as cell harvesting, protein separation, and vaccine production. These centrifuges are instrumental in ensuring the purity and quality of pharmaceutical products by effectively separating different components based on their density.

In the pharmaceutical industry, tubular centrifuges are also used in the purification of various compounds and in the isolation of specific biomolecules. These centrifuges aid in the separation of particles based on their size, shape, and density, allowing for the extraction of pure substances for further processing. The high centrifugal forces generated by tubular centrifuges enable efficient separation of particles, making them an essential tool in pharmaceutical research and production.

Furthermore, tubular centrifuges are often employed in the pharmaceutical industry for the clarification of fermentation broths and the separation of antibiotics and other pharmaceutical compounds. The ability of tubular centrifuges to operate continuously with high reliability makes them an ideal choice for various pharmaceutical applications where continuous separation processes are required.

Food and Beverage Industry

The food and beverage industry is another sector where tubular centrifuges find widespread use. These centrifuges are commonly employed in food processing and beverage production plants for the separation of liquids, solids, and oils. Tubular centrifuges are used in the clarification of juices, the separation of fats and oils, and the purification of various food products.

In the food industry, tubular centrifuges play a crucial role in the production of edible oils, dairy products, and fruit juices. These centrifuges are used to separate solid impurities, water, and other contaminants from food products, ensuring the quality and purity of the final product. Tubular centrifuges are also utilized in the processing of beverages such as beer, wine, and spirits, where they aid in the clarification and filtration of the liquid medium.

Additionally, tubular centrifuges are commonly used in the food and beverage industry for the extraction of bioactive compounds from plant materials and the separation of protein fractions from food products. These centrifuges provide a cost-effective and efficient solution for food processing companies looking to improve the quality and yield of their products.

Biotechnology Industry

In the biotechnology industry, tubular centrifuges are widely used for various applications such as cell harvesting, cell separation, and protein purification. These centrifuges play a significant role in biotechnological processes by facilitating the separation and purification of biomolecules for research and production purposes. Tubular centrifuges are commonly employed in biotechnology laboratories, pharmaceutical companies, and research institutions for cell culture applications, vaccine production, and DNA isolation.

In the biotechnology industry, tubular centrifuges are used for the separation of cells, cell debris, and proteins from culture media, allowing for the isolation and purification of specific biomolecules. These centrifuges enable researchers and biotechnologists to obtain pure and concentrated samples for further analysis and experimentation. Tubular centrifuges are also utilized in the biotechnology industry for the separation of recombinant proteins, the purification of enzymes, and the isolation of nucleic acids.

Additionally, tubular centrifuges are employed in the biotechnology industry for the concentration of cell suspensions, the clarification of fermentation broths, and the extraction of intracellular products. These centrifuges offer a high level of performance, reliability, and flexibility, making them an essential tool in biotechnological research and production processes.
